Orissa Bengal Carrier Ltd. Share Price fell to Rs 46.85 on 18 August 2026, down 13.24% from the previous close of Rs 54, leaving the logistics company with a market capitalisation of Rs 115.77 crore. The move put the stock on the market radar as a top decliner in early BSE trade and made it relevant for traders and long-term trackers following micro-cap price action in the Indian stock market.
The supplied data confirms a same-day share price decline of Rs 7.15, with the stock opening at Rs 46.85 and remaining at that same level for the session high and session low at the time of the update. That kind of one-price print does not establish a company-specific catalyst, but it does confirm that selling pressure was strong enough to push the stock immediately below its previous close and keep it there. In Stock Market Today terms, this is a clear event-driven price fall rather than a routine fluctuation.

Orissa Bengal Carrier Ltd. operates in the Logistics sector and Logistics industry, and the supplied benchmark compares it with 82 companies in the same industry. That matters because a single-day share price decline is easier to interpret when the company’s valuation and return profile are placed against the exact sector backdrop rather than against the broader market alone.
The sector snapshot shows Orissa Bengal Carrier Ltd.’s company P/E at -11.63, versus a same-industry median P/E of 14.62 and average of 25.97 across 75 companies with available P/E data. The industry P/E range runs from 2.22 to 176.52. Because OBCL’s P/E is negative, it sits outside the normal profitable valuation band represented by the median and average, which highlights that current earnings context is weaker than the typical profitable logistics peer in the benchmark.
On price-to-book, the company stands at 1.34 compared with a median of 1.19 and average of 1.93 across 82 companies. That places the stock slightly above the industry median on P/B but below the average, suggesting its balance-sheet valuation is not an extreme outlier inside the sector. Profitability also appears middling rather than dominant. Company ROE is 8.08 against a median ROE of 9.89 and an average of -8.22 across 80 companies. Company ROCE is 10.18 against a median of 11.45 and an average of 16.2 across 80 companies. So on both ROE and ROCE, the company trails the industry median.
Market capitalisation offers more context. At Rs 115.77 crore, Orissa Bengal Carrier Ltd. is above the industry median market cap of Rs 105.07 crore, but well below the average of Rs 309.29 crore, which is influenced by larger players. The benchmark range spans from Rs 2.4 crore to Rs 2,743.04 crore. Peer comparison helps place Orissa Bengal Carrier Ltd. inside the listed logistics universe rather than viewing the price fall in isolation. With a market cap of Rs 115.77 crore, OBCL is much smaller than the larger supplied peers such as Gateway Distriparks at Rs 2,743.04 crore, TCI Express at Rs 2,155.95 crore and Allcargo Logistics at Rs 1,497.78 crore. It is also below Navkar Corporation at Rs 1,496.91 crore and Reliance Industrial Infrastructure at Rs 1,120.95 crore. That scale gap matters because smaller stocks can show sharper percentage moves on relatively limited trading activity.
On valuation, OBCL’s P/E of -11.63 stands apart from profitable peers such as Gateway Distriparks at 11.27, TCI Express at 26.43, Allcargo Logistics at 50.23, Navkar Corporation at 37.29 and Reliance Industrial Infrastructure at 92.69. The contrast shows that while peer multiples span a very wide range, most of the named comparables are being valued on positive earnings, unlike OBCL. By P/B, OBCL at 1.34 sits above Gateway Distriparks at 1.17 and Navkar Corporation at 0.76, but below TCI Express at 2.61, Allcargo Logistics at 2.56 and Reliance Industrial Infrastructure at 2.36.
Return metrics also place the company in the middle-to-lower portion of this peer set. OBCL’s ROE of 8.08 is below Gateway Distriparks at 10.04, far below TCI Express at 26.69 and Western Carriers at 25.57, but above Allcargo Logistics at 4.29, Navkar Corporation at 2.04 and Reliance Industrial Infrastructure at 1.97. Its ROCE of 10.18 is below Gateway Distriparks at 13.23, TCI Express at 35.54 and TEJAS CARGO INDIA LIMITED at 12.97, but above Allcargo Logistics at 7.98, Navkar Corporation at 2.59 and Reliance Industrial Infrastructure at 2.53.
